The Importance of Regular Cleaning of the Mask

The mask needs to be cleaned regularly to maintain the effectiveness of the therapy, prevent bacteria and germs from proliferating, and minimize the risk of infection. The mask’s cleaning instructions often come with the device manual and should be followed stringently. Besides, individuals with allergies should consider using hypoallergenic cleaning solutions and detergents to prevent skin irritations and other health complications.

The mask should be cleaned daily. Wiping with a damp cloth and using a mild soap/detergent solution can be used to clean the mask. Deep cleaning should be done weekly where it is recommended that the mask be soaked in a solution of 1-part vinegar and 3 parts water for 30 minutes and then thoroughly rinsed and allowed to dry.

Question and Answer

How can I prevent leaks from my mask?

You can adjust your mask so that it fits snuggly without being too tight, try different masks, different straps, and cushions. It’s essential to use the most comfortable pillow for your sleeping position.

What could happen if I don’t clean my mask?

Regular cleaning of the mask is essential to prevent the mask from becoming an incubator for germs, and bacteria and increase the risk of contracting infections like cold, flu and COVID 19.

Can I use the same cleaning solution for my mask and tubing?

Yes, the same cleaning solution can be used for the mask and tubing. Always rinse with cold water and allow it to thoroughly dry before using it for therapy.

How often should I replace my mask?

The mask can last between 6-12 months depending on its usage. However, it’s essential to regularly inspect the mask for wear and tear and replace it immediately if it’s damaged.
